
We all have good intentions when it comes to our health. We want to eat better, move more, and get enough sleep. But intentions alone don’t drive results; your calendar does.
Because what actually gets scheduled is what actually happens.
If your days are filled with meetings, work, errands, and responsibilities, but there’s no time set aside for your health, then your results will always reflect that. Not because you don’t care, but because it was never given a real place in your day.
This is one of the most eye-opening things we walk clients through. We don’t look at what they hope to do—we look at what their week actually looks like. And almost every time, the answer becomes clear.
Health isn’t missing because of a lack of knowledge. It’s missing because it hasn’t been prioritized in a tangible way.
Even small shifts, like blocking 30 minutes for a walk, planning meals ahead of time, or setting a consistent wind-down routine, can completely change how your week feels. When it’s on your calendar, it becomes real.
